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Carga EV en West Silver Spring

Cuál es el apartamento con Carga EV más barato en West Silver Spring?

Actualmente el apartamento con Carga EV más accequible en West Silver Spring está en The Blairs listado en $1,396.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Carga EV en West Silver Spring?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Carga EV en West Silver Spring es $2,936.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Carga EV más grande en West Silver Spring?

A día de hoy el apartamento con Carga EV y más metros cuadrados en West Silver Spring una unidad de 1,500 a partir de $1,396 en The Blairs.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Carga EV en West Silver Spring?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Carga EV en West Silver Spring es actualmente de 548 sq ft.
